With exports of 13,300 units, total monthly sales stood at 61,137 units, marking 4.1 per cent growth in May 2026 from last year, the company said in a statement.
“In the first two months (April and May) of FY27, HMIL witnessed domestic sales rise by 13 per cent to 99,739 units, compared to 88,235 units in the same period of FY26,” Tarun Garg, MD & CEO, HMIL, said.
